Sgaawaay K’uuna (Edge of the Knife)

September 22, 2019
Part drama, part historical reclamation, this film charts a simple narrative about a reckless uncle who can't bare the guilt of having led his nephew to his demise told entirely in the Haida language.

Yayoi Kusama: Infinity

October 13, 2019
Explore the journey of Yayoi Kusama from conservative upbringing to her brush with fame in America during the 1960s to the Tokyo mental institution she has called home for over 30 years.

There Are No Fakes

November 10, 2019
A painting, thought to be the work of Normal Morrisseau, leads the painting's owner, Kevin Hearn of the Barenaked Ladies, into the tragic and brutal world of an art forgery ring in Canada's north.
